Intro
In today's contemporary homes, plumbing services are evolving to satisfy the needs of performance, sustainability, and benefit. From clever leakage detection systems to energy-efficient components, property owners currently have a large selection of innovative options to select from.
Remote-Controlled Plumbing Solutions
Remote-controlled plumbing systems allow property owners to keep an eye on and regulate their plumbing fixtures from anywhere utilizing a smart device or tablet computer. From changing water temperature level to discovering leaks, these systems provide benefit and satisfaction.
Smart Leak Detection Solutions
Among the most considerable advancements in plumbing technology is the growth of smart leakage detection systems. These systems use sensing units and algorithms to discover leakages early, protecting against water damage and saving property owners from expensive repairs.
Greywater Recycling Solutions
Greywater recycling systems gather and deal with wastewater from sinks, showers, and laundry appliances for reuse in irrigation and various other non-potable applications. By reusing greywater, home owners can reduce water usage and contribute to sustainable living methods.
Solar Water Heating Equipments
Solar water heating systems harness the power of the sun to warmth water for domestic use. By setting up solar batteries on the roof, property owners can lower their reliance on traditional water heaters and reduced their power expenses while reducing their carbon footprint.
Hydronic Home Heating Equipments
Hydronic heater utilize water to disperse warm throughout a home, providing effective and comfy warmth during the chillier months. These systems can be powered by various energy sources, consisting of gas boilers, heat pumps, and solar thermal collectors.
Water-Efficient Landscaping
Creating water-efficient landscapes is another fad in contemporary plumbing. By selecting drought-resistant plants, setting up permeable hardscapes, and including rain harvesting systems, house owners can decrease water usage while maintaining a stunning and lasting exterior room.
Smart Irrigation Systems
Smart watering systems utilize sensing units and weather information to maximize watering schedules and minimize water waste. These systems can change sprinkling times based on soil wetness levels, rains projections, and plant needs, ensuring reliable water usage for outdoor landscape design.

High-Efficiency Fixtures and Appliances
Another trend in modern-day plumbing is the use of high-efficiency fixtures and home appliances. From low-flow bathrooms to water-saving dish washers, these components and home appliances are designed to lessen water use without compromising performance.
Tankless Hot Water Heater
Tankless hot water heater are becoming significantly popular in contemporary homes due to their power performance and on-demand hot water delivery. Unlike typical water heaters, tankless models warm water as it passes through the device, getting rid of the need for a large storage tank.
Anti-Scald Faucets and Showerheads
Anti-scald faucets and showerheads are created to avoid burns and injuries by regulating water temperature level and flow. These components feature integrated thermostatic valves that keep a constant temperature level, even if there are fluctuations in water pressure.
Motion-Activated Faucets
Motion-activated faucets are a hassle-free and hygienic choice for modern-day kitchens and bathrooms. By spotting motion, these faucets automatically activate and off, reducing the spread of germs and saving water.
Water Filtering and Purification Equipments
Making sure tidy and risk-free drinking water is necessary for contemporary home owners. Water filtration and purification systems get rid of pollutants and pollutants, offering satisfaction and enhancing general wellness and well-being.
Verdict
Cutting-edge plumbing remedies use house owners the opportunity to improve performance, sustainability, and ease in their homes. From clever leak detection systems to solar water heating systems, these advancements are transforming the method we think of plumbing and water monitoring.
Plumbing Innovations You Should Know About
Plumbing technology continues to evolve over the years. New advancements in plumbing can offer you multiple benefits, from saving you money on monthly bills and repair fees, to making your home more energy efficient. If you want to improve your plumbing in general, consider implementing some of these innovations in your home.
Trenchless Technology
A common problem with many households in Texas is the disruption and failure of sewer lines and other underground systems due to tree roots or other factors. While plumbers used to destroy lawns by creating trenches to fix these issues, trenchless methods have proven effective, eliminating previous drawbacks. For instance, pipe relining allows a plumber to coat pipes with an adhesive that lasts for several years. The plumber only needs to dig a single hole and use a camera and hydraulic equipment to apply it.
Touchless Plumbing
Homeowners are increasingly using touchless plumbing equipment in their home, such as touchless toilets or faucets, which are usually associated with commercial locations. This touchless technology uses motion sensors that detect the user’s movements to function. People use hands-free plumbing to prevent the spread of germs and diseases, as well as for aesthetic pleasure. Touchless faucets are more popular than touchless toilets in households and come with a variety of designs.
Energy Efficient Water Heaters
Several innovations in water heating have increased energy efficiency without giving up the quality of the service. For example, insulated water heaters cut heat losses by 24-25%, and save you 7-16% on the water bill on a yearly basis. Tankless water heaters also reduce the large consumption of water caused by tanks through on-demand water heating when you turn on the hot water. Other efficient water heater alternatives include heat pump and solar systems.
PEX Piping
The use of crosslinked polyethylene (PEX) in piping, as opposed to copper, is rising due to the numerous innovations the material brings. PEX is not a metal, so it has no vulnerability to corrosion. Also, PEX piping has fewer connection points, limiting the risk of a leak. Finally, its flexibility allows for fitting around corners and different connections, so you can save the money you would normally spend on extra supplies and material.
